'does not strip an escaped trailing newline in an attribute value'|'uid=John Smith\\\n,ou=People,dc=example,dc=com'|'uid=john smith\\\n,ou=people,dc=example,dc=com'
'does not strip an escaped trailing newline in an attribute value'|'uid=John Smith\\\n,ou=People,dc=example,dc=com'|'uid=john smith\\\n,ou=people,dc=example,dc=com'
'does not strip an unescaped leading newline (actually an invalid DN)'|'uid=\nJohn Smith,ou=People,dc=example,dc=com'|'uid=\njohn smith,ou=people,dc=example,dc=com'
'does not strip an unescaped leading newline (actually an invalid DN)'|'uid=\nJohn Smith,ou=People,dc=example,dc=com'|'uid=\njohn smith,ou=people,dc=example,dc=com'
'does not strip an unescaped trailing newline (actually an invalid DN)'|'uid=John Smith\n ,ou=People,dc=example,dc=com'|'uid=john smith\n,ou=people,dc=example,dc=com'
'does not strip an unescaped trailing newline (actually an invalid DN)'|'uid=John Smith\n ,ou=People,dc=example,dc=com'|'uid=john smith\n,ou=people,dc=example,dc=com'
'does not strip non whitespace'|'uid=John Smith,ou=People,dc=example,dc=com'|'uid=john smith,ou=people,dc=example,dc=com'
'does not strip if no extraneous whitespace'|'uid=John Smith,ou=People,dc=example,dc=com'|'uid=john smith,ou=people,dc=example,dc=com'
'does not treat escaped equal signs as attribute delimiters'|'uid= foo \\= bar'|'uid=foo \\= bar'
'does not treat escaped equal signs as attribute delimiters'|'uid= foo \\= bar'|'uid=foo \\= bar'
'does not treat escaped hex equal signs as attribute delimiters'|'uid= foo \\3D bar'|'uid=foo \\3d bar'
'does not treat escaped hex equal signs as attribute delimiters'|'uid= foo \\3D bar'|'uid=foo \\3d bar'
'does not treat escaped commas as attribute delimiters'|'uid= John C. Smith, ou=San Francisco\\, CA'|'uid=john c. smith,ou=san francisco\\, ca'
'does not treat escaped commas as attribute delimiters'|'uid= John C. Smith, ou=San Francisco\\, CA'|'uid=john c. smith,ou=san francisco\\, ca'